
At New Chitose Airport, three individuals, including Ryo Moroyu, a restaurant owner from Niseko, Hokkaido, were arrested and charged with importing cannabis seeds. The seeds, packaged stylishly, were found hidden in the pocket of swimwear within a suitcase during an immigration inspection aided by a drug-sniffing dog.
The three suspects allegedly conspired to import 37 viable cannabis seeds from Thailand on June 5. While their exact plea regarding the charges remains unclear, they reportedly stated that they purchased 40 seeds for approximately 47,000 yen from a cannabis shop. The arrests were made under suspicion of violating laws regulating the cultivation of cannabis plants.
